 2. Mozilla Firefox: The Speedy Open-Source Juggernaut

The Official Logo of Mozilla Firefox, the best internet browser for gamers.
Mozilla Firefox is a fast browser with a lot of options.

Ah, Mozilla Firefox – the maverick of the browsing world. Firefox, with its emphasis on privacy and speed, feels like a breath of fresh air. I remember tweaking Firefox’s settings to get that edge in my game – those split-second load times truly matter.

Firefox is light on resources, which means your gaming rig breathes easy, unlike the suffocating grasp of heavier browsers. Its Quantum engine boosts load times significantly, and did I mention the multi-account containers? Managing different gaming profiles or accounts has never been easier – it’s like having separate lockers for your in-game personas.

 3. Opera GX: The Gamer’s Browser

The Official Logo of Opera GX, the best internet browser for gamers.
Opera GX is solely based for gamers.

Now here’s a browser that screams gaming – imagine walking into a room glowing with neon lights, and that’s Opera GX for you. Specifically crafted for gamers, it feels like it’s tuned to your heartbeat during an intense raid.

I once used Opera GX’s RAM and CPU limiters while streaming – talk about smooth sailing! The GX Corner is my personal favorite and it’s no excessive if I say it is the best internet browser for gamers: an organized treasure trove of gaming news, deals, and release calendars. The Discord and Twitch integrations mean staying connected with my squad without hopping tabs. And those vibrant customizations? It’s like having a browser with a high-score ranking feature.

 4. Microsoft Edge: The Underdog’s Resurgence

The Official Logo of Microsoft Edge, the best internet browser for gamers.
Other than being a browser, Microsoft Edge Helps Gamers with all their AI needs.

Who would’ve thought? From the clutches of Internet Explorer, Microsoft Edge has emerged like a phoenix. The Chromium boost has turned Edge into a stealthy contender for gamers, especially those cozy with Windows.

The seamless integration with Windows 10 and 11 enhances the gaming experience. I’ve found myself using Edge to manage my Xbox game library directly – no more juggling multiple windows. Plus, its efficiency mode conserves resources, making sure my game performance stays unhindered. It’s like rediscovering an old flame, but better.

 5. Brave Browser: The Privacy Pioneer

The Official Logo of Brave Browser, the best internet browser for gamers.
Brave Browser is fast, secure and offers you earnings.

Privacy-conscious gamers, gather around – Brave is your knight in shining armor. I still recall the first time I used Brave; the speed was jaw-dropping. Blocking those intrusive ads and trackers not only safeguarded my privacy but also sped up my browsing.

Brave’s lightweight build means it doesn’t gulp down resources, leaving more muscle power for the game. The rewards program, where you earn tokens by opting into privacy-friendly ads, is like a side quest with actual loot! And the native Tor support adds that extra layer of anonymity, ideal for late-night gaming marathons.

 10. Maxthon: The Multiplatform Performer

The Official Logo of Maxthon, the best internet browser for gamers.

Maxthon may not be the talk of the town, but its cloud-based functionalities cater beautifully to gamers hopping between devices. Its dual-rendering engines ensure compatibility across diverse websites and applications, essential for gaming.

I’ve appreciated Maxthon’s built-in ad blocker and screen capture tools – they add layers of finesse to my browsing experience. Its split-screen feature is a godsend for multitasking, making Maxthon an under-the-radar powerhouse. It’s like finding a rare artifact that enhances every aspect of your quest.
